1.0what is data integrity?
a. the process of compressing data to save space
b. the idea that data sent over the internet is accurate when it arrives
c. the process of encrypting data for security
d. the process of backing up data to prevent loss
Data integrity refers to the accuracy, consistency, and reliability of data throughout its lifecycle, including when it is transmitted. Option A describes data compression, option C describes data encryption, option D describes data backup, none of which define data integrity.
